Job description

Company Overview

LD power automation is a leading engineering company specializing in marine and industrial electrical and control services and products. With extensive experience in installation, commissioning, and troubleshooting, we deliver professional and timely solutions that help our clients achieve operational excellence. Our commitment to building strong, long-term relationships is founded on trust and a deep understanding of our clients\' needs. For more information, visit our website.

Job Summary

Join a fast-moving, nimble team at the intersection of stability and innovation. We\'re an established small business entering an exciting startup phase; scaling rapidly, experimenting boldly, and building the future of our tech stack from the ground up. As a Software Engineer, you\'ll play a hands-on role in shaping our Linux-first infrastructure, solving real-world problems, and delivering high-impact solutions in a collaborative, no-red-tape environment. If you thrive in fast-paced settings, love autonomy, and want your work to matter from day one, we want to meet you.
